More growth for vans in July


New van registrations continued to grow in July, revealed the Society of Motor Manufacturers and Traders (SMMT).
17,309 new vans were sold last month, an increase of over 25 per cent on the same period last year, resulting in a 0.1 per cent rise to 204,514 for the rolling year.
This takes the year-to-date figure to 124,579, a 17.03 per cent increase on the same period in 2009.
Ford and Vauxhall were the top two sellers - no doubt boosted by buoyant sales of the Transit and new Movano – while Citroen, Peugeot and Renault all figured in the top ten best-sellers list.
The new van market was one of the only sectors to show signs of growth in July, which was a bad month for the industry as a whole. Paul Everitt, SMMT chief executive surmised: “July was another surprisingly good month for vans, with useful growth."
